      • setThrowExceptionOnFailure

        public void setThrowExceptionOnFailure​(boolean throwExceptionOnFailure)
        Option to disable throwing the HttpOperationFailedException in case of failed responses from the remote server. This allows you to get all responses regardless of the HTTP status code.
      • isTransferException

        public boolean isTransferException()
      • setTransferException

        public void setTransferException​(boolean transferException)
        If enabled and an Exchange failed processing on the consumer side, and if the caused Exception was send back serialized in the response as a application/x-java-serialized-object content type. On the producer side the exception will be deserialized and thrown as is, instead of the HttpOperationFailedException. The caused exception is required to be serialized.

        This is by default turned off. If you enable this then be aware that Java will deserialize the incoming data from the request to Java and that can be a potential security risk.

      • setUrlDecodeHeaders

        public void setUrlDecodeHeaders​(boolean urlDecodeHeaders)
        If this option is enabled, then during binding from Netty to Camel Message then the header values will be URL decoded (eg %20 will be a space character. Notice this option is used by the default org.apache.camel.component.netty.http.NettyHttpBinding and therefore if you implement a custom org.apache.camel.component.netty.http.NettyHttpBinding then you would need to decode the headers accordingly to this option.
      • isMapHeaders

        public boolean isMapHeaders()
      • setMapHeaders

        public void setMapHeaders​(boolean mapHeaders)
        If this option is enabled, then during binding from Netty to Camel Message then the headers will be mapped as well (eg added as header to the Camel Message as well). You can turn off this option to disable this. The headers can still be accessed from the org.apache.camel.component.netty.http.NettyHttpMessage message with the method getHttpRequest() that returns the Netty HTTP request io.netty.handler.codec.http.HttpRequest instance.

      • setBridgeEndpoint

        public void setBridgeEndpoint​(boolean bridgeEndpoint)
        If the option is true, the producer will ignore the Exchange.HTTP_URI header, and use the endpoint's URI for request. You may also set the throwExceptionOnFailure to be false to let the producer send all the fault response back. The consumer working in the bridge mode will skip the gzip compression and WWW URL form encoding (by adding the Exchange.SKIP_GZIP_ENCODING and Exchange.SKIP_WWW_FORM_URLENCODED headers to the consumed exchange).

      • setDisableStreamCache

        public void setDisableStreamCache​(boolean disableStreamCache)
        Determines whether or not the raw input stream from Netty HttpRequest#getContent() or HttpResponset#getContent() is cached or not (Camel will read the stream into a in light-weight memory based Stream caching) cache. By default Camel will cache the Netty input stream to support reading it multiple times to ensure it Camel can retrieve all data from the stream. However you can set this option to true when you for example need to access the raw stream, such as streaming it directly to a file or other persistent store. Mind that if you enable this option, then you cannot read the Netty stream multiple times out of the box, and you would need manually to reset the reader index on the Netty raw stream. Also Netty will auto-close the Netty stream when the Netty HTTP server/HTTP client is done processing, which means that if the asynchronous routing engine is in use then any asynchronous thread that may continue routing the Exchange may not be able to read the Netty stream, because Netty has closed it.

      • setSend503whenSuspended

        public void setSend503whenSuspended​(boolean send503whenSuspended)
        Whether to send back HTTP status code 503 when the consumer has been suspended. If the option is false then the Netty Acceptor is unbound when the consumer is suspended, so clients cannot connect anymore.

      • setMaxHeaderSize

        public void setMaxHeaderSize​(int maxHeaderSize)
        The maximum length of all headers. If the sum of the length of each header exceeds this value, a TooLongFrameException will be raised.
      • getOkStatusCodeRange

        public String getOkStatusCodeRange()
      • setOkStatusCodeRange

        public void setOkStatusCodeRange​(String okStatusCodeRange)
        The status codes which are considered a success response. The values are inclusive. Multiple ranges can be defined, separated by comma, e.g. 200-204,209,301-304. Each range must be a single number or from-to with the dash included.

        The default range is 200-299
